Published Navigating underground with cosmic-ray muons
(via sciencedaily.com)
Original source 
Superfast, subatomic-sized particles called muons have been used to wirelessly navigate underground in a reportedly world first. By using muon-detecting ground stations synchronized with an underground muon-detecting receiver, researchers were able to calculate the receiver's position in the basement of a six-story building. As GPS cannot penetrate rock or water, this new technology could be used in future search and rescue efforts, to monitor undersea volcanoes, and guide autonomous vehicles underground and underwater.

Published We've pumped so much groundwater that we've nudged Earth's spin
(via sciencedaily.com)
Original source 
By pumping water out of the ground and moving it elsewhere, humans have shifted such a large mass of water that the Earth tilted nearly 80 centimeters (31.5 inches) east between 1993 and 2010 alone, according to a new study.

Published Cleaner air with a cold catalytic converter
(via sciencedaily.com)
Original source 
Although passenger vehicle catalytic converters have been mandatory for over 30 years, there is still plenty of room for improvement. For instance, they only work correctly when the engine is sufficiently hot, which is not always the case, especially with hybrid vehicles. Researchers have now developed an improved catalyst that can properly purify exhaust gases even at room temperature.

Published The life below our feet: Team discovers microbes thriving in groundwater and producing oxygen in the dark
(via sciencedaily.com)
Original source 
A survey of groundwater samples drawn from aquifers beneath more than 80,000 square miles of Canadian prairie reveals ancient groundwaters harbor not only diverse and active microbial communities, but also unexpectedly large numbers of microbial cells. Strikingly, some of these microbes seem to produce 'dark oxygen' (in the absence of sunlight) in such abundance that the oxygen may nourish not only those microbes, but may leak into the environment and support other oxygen-reliant microbes that can't produce it themselves.

Published The Viking disease can be due to gene variants inherited from Neanderthals
(via sciencedaily.com)
Original source 
Many men in northern Europe over the age of 60 suffer from the so-called Viking disease, which means that the fingers lock in a bent position. Now researchers have used data from over 7,000 affected individuals to look for genetic risk factors for the disease. The findings show that three of the strongest risk factors are inherited from Neanderthals.
Published Aluminium-ion batteries with improved storage capacity
(via sciencedaily.com)
Original source 
Scientists develop positive electrode material using an organic redox polymer based on phenothiazine. Aluminium-ion batteries containing this material stored an unprecedented 167 milliampere hours per gram, outperforming batteries using graphite as electrode material. Aluminium-ion batteries are considered a promising alternative to conventional batteries that use scarce raw materials such as lithium.
